Faculty, Computer IT (#9517) KW
Job Functions;
Primary responsibility is to teach a full range of freshman and sophomore computer information technology and programming courses at a variety of times, formats and locations, as appropriate.
Makes continuous efforts to improve the quality of instruction by reviewing and utilizing innovative methodologies, techniques, and delivery methods.
Develops and uses a syllabus for each course or laboratory within college and departmental guidelines.
Plans, develops and uses a variety of teaching methods and materials that assist students in meeting course objectives and which are appropriate for students with differing educational and experiential backgrounds and learning styles.
Evaluates students to measure their progress toward achievement of stated course objectives and informs them in a timely manner of their progress in the course.
Submits required college reports and forms.
Reviews, evaluates, and recommends student learning materials.
Maintains professional relationships with students, colleagues and the community.
Provides access to students through posted office hours, electronic communication and other appropriate methods.
Responsible for professional development and institutional service as determined in consultation with the Dean.
Responsible for other reasonable, related duties as assigned.
Required Qualifications;
Master's degree in computer science, computer information systems, computer information technology, computer engineering, or computer-based information systems, or related fields. Master's degree with 18 graduate hours in a specific area of technology
